Elon Musk Teases AI-Powered Video Platform Grok Imagine with a Nod to Vine’s Legacy

In a surprising turn of events, tech mogul Elon Musk has stirred intrigue by hinting at a potential revival of the once-beloved video platform, Vine. Known for its six-second looping videos that captivated millions, Vine was a major player in the social media landscape, paving the way for platforms like TikTok. While Vine fizzled out in early 2017, its cultural impact lingered, giving rise to internet personalities and meme culture. Musk’s announcement came alongside the introduction of a new AI tool, positioning it as a modern homage to Vine.

Zooming In

Introducing ‘Grok Imagine’: The AI Innovation

Elon Musk introduced “Grok Imagine,” an AI-driven video generation platform that he equates to Vine’s legacy in the AI domain. This tool promises to transform user-generated prompts into engaging video content, leveraging advancements in generative AI to create highly nuanced video snippets. Musk suggests, “Grok Imagine is AI Vine,” highlighting its potential to disrupt and innovate the social media sphere with intelligent video content production.

Rediscovering Vine’s Lost Archive

Alongside the launch of Grok Imagine, Musk revealed that his team has fortuitously rediscovered the Vine video archive, long thought to be lost. He hinted at restoring user access to these nostalgic clips, allowing past creators and fans to revisit their snippets of creativity. This endeavor is Musk’s nod to Vine’s creative spirit, acknowledging its influence on today’s digital media trends.

A Glimpse into the Past: Vine’s Brief but Impactful Journey

Vine launched in 2013 and swiftly became the top free app on the App Store. By 2015, it amassed over 200 million active users before Twitter, its owner, opted to discontinue the service in 2017. Despite its short lifespan, Vine’s unique format spawned viral stars and cultivated a vibrant online subculture. An interim archive was available until 2019, preserving some of its rich content for posterity.
